By The Numbers: Dustin Poirier vs. Justin Gaethje UFC291 via bknapp52635
As Poirier and Gaethje make final preparations for their forthcoming showdown at 155 pounds, a look at some of the numbers that have accompanied them to this point:Poirier wins by submission, accounting for 28% of his career total . His methods of choice: three armbars, two brabo chokes, one triangle armbar, one body triangle and one rear-naked choke.
Poirier owns 14 other wins by knockout or technical knockout and seven more by decision .Significant strikes by which Poirier outlanded Gaethje in their first encounter. He connected with 174 such strikes while absorbing 115 of them in return.Rounds started by Poirier as a professional mixed martial artist. He has gone the distance on nine different occasions and carries a 7-2 record in those bouts.
